Output 859032bb86858566f56223cb826d3a241e07067da1b5161f5074a38c817e83d7:0

value
72494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47555be09c2113aefd2ef47e1db1e3c6040862b0 OP_EQUAL
address
38CCA1AyxtkoHw5RgAEu4DYPkdJLSYPjjD
transaction
859032bb86858566f56223cb826d3a241e07067da1b5161f5074a38c817e83d7